比特币钱包密码破解的基本原理是利用密码学知识和特定算法对可能的密码进行猜测,以找到正确的密码。常用的密码破解方法包括暴力破解、字典攻击和蛮力攻击等。暴力破解是逐个尝试所有可能的组合,直到找到正确的密码;字典攻击则是使用预先准备好的密码词典进行尝试;蛮力攻击则是通过排列组合和递归算法来逐个尝试所有的可能性。
1. 密码长度和复杂度:越长、越复杂的密码破解难度越大,因此选择一个强密码是保护比特币钱包的重要因素之一。
2. 多种密码尝试:使用不同的密码破解方法进行尝试,如暴力破解、字典攻击和蛮力攻击等,提高破解成功的概率。
3. 针对特定钱包类型的攻击:不同类型的比特币钱包使用的加密算法和存储方式不同,可以根据钱包类型选择相应的破解技巧。
4. 利用弱密码和常见密码:部分用户设置弱密码或使用常见密码,这给破解者提供了破解的机会,因此需要避免使用弱密码和常见密码。
5. 社交工程:使用社交工程手段获取用户信息,如生日、姓名、手机号等,来尝试猜测密码。
1. 使用强密码:选择一个8位以上的密码,包括数字、大小写字母和特殊字符,增加破解难度。
2. 定期更改密码:定期更改密码可以避免密码长期被暴露,提高比特币钱包的安全性。
3. 使用双重认证:开启双重认证功能,可以在登录时需要输入除密码外的额外验证信息,增加安全性。
4. 谨慎使用在线钱包:在线钱包容易受到网络攻击,建议使用离线钱包,将比特币存储在安全的硬件设备中。
5. 定期备份钱包:定期备份比特币钱包,并将备份文件存储在安全、离线的地方,以防止钱包丢失或损坏。
1. 合法性在破解比特币钱包密码时,必须确保自己有合法的授权,否则将涉及到非法入侵他人隐私的问题。
2. 资源消耗:密码破解需要耗费大量的时间和计算资源,需要计算机算力强大的设备支持,同时考虑电力和散热问题。
3. 隐私保护:在破解过程中,应尊重用户隐私,不得泄露用户的任何个人信息。
4. 法律风险:密码破解活动可能涉及违法行为,如未经授权擅自破解他人的比特币钱包密码,可能会触犯相关法律法规,需要注意法律风险。
5. 后果承担:未经授权的密码破解行为可能会导致不可预测的后果,包括法律责任、倫理問題以及道德批判等,需明确风险和责任承担。
1. 及时联系相关机构:一旦发现比特币钱包被破解或存在风险,及时联系相关机构,如比特币交易所、钱包服务提供商等,进行处理。
2. 冻结钱包资产:请求相关机构冻结被破解的比特币钱包,并停止任何不正常的资金流动。
3. 调查与追踪:与相关执法机构合作,协助进行调查与追踪破解者身份,尽可能追回被盗的比特币。
4. 提高安全性:破解后,加强钱包的安全性,更新密码、启用双重认证等措施,以防止再次被攻击。
5. 寻求法律援助:根据实际情况,如损失较大或涉及重大权益,可以寻求法律援助,保障自身权益。